It analyzes more than 50 million real estate investor transactions and maintains a database of more than 10 million buyers nationwide. Instead of relying solely on static cash-buyer lists, InvestorBase lets users search and analyze investors based on their actual purchase activity. For a specific property, Buyer Search and SmartMatch identify investors whose historical buying behavior suggests they may be a fit for the deal. Users can then analyze those buyers, access available skip-traced contact information, organize buyer relationships, market deals, and manage offers through the disposition process. The goal is simple: help real estate professionals answer the question, "Who is most likely to buy this property?" ## What InvestorBase does - Buyer Search: Search a nationwide database of real estate investors and analyze their actual purchasing activity. InvestorBase is focused on the buyer and disposition side of real estate investing. The core question it answers is not "Who owns property?" but "Who is most likely to buy this deal?" It combines investor transaction data, buyer search, buyer matching, skip tracing, buyer management, and disposition tools around that problem. - Versus static cash-buyer lists: A static cash-buyer list tells a user who has purchased properties. InvestorBase helps users understand which investors are relevant to a specific opportunity by analyzing their purchasing activity, because the best buyer for one property may be irrelevant for another. InvestorBase is a buyer intelligence and disposition platform rather than a downloadable cash-buyer list. - Versus skip-tracing services: Skip tracing answers "How can I contact this person or company?" InvestorBase answers the question that comes before it, "Which investors should I contact?", and then provides available skip-traced contact information for those buyers. Skip tracing is included with InvestorBase subscriptions. - Versus a dispo CRM: A traditional CRM primarily helps organize relationships a user already has. InvestorBase helps users both discover new buyers and manage existing buyers, so buyer discovery, investor transaction intelligence, SmartMatch, skip tracing, Buyers Lists, deal marketing, landing pages, and offer management exist within the same workflow. ## Pricing InvestorBase offers monthly, quarterly, and annual subscription options.
